National Statistical Service (NSS) Leadership Branch

The National Statistical Service Leadership Branch is made up of two Sections: Statistical Coordination (Statistical Clearing House (SCH) and National Statistical Service (NSS) teams) and the National Data Network (NDN) Business Office.

The Statistical Clearing House is responsible for reviewing all surveys involving 50 or more businesses conducted by or on behalf of Australian Government departments and agencies. The primary purpose of the SCH is to reduce the burden of Australian Government surveys on businesses by ensuring such surveys do not duplicate existing collections and are of sufficient quality to warrant the burden imposed. The Clearing House is celebrating its 10th birthday in October 2007.

The National Statistical Service (NSS) team has a particularly important role in driving overall NSS strategy taken by the ABS and providing leadership on key cross cutting projects. Specifically, the area:

  • assists the development of NSS policy and strategy;
  • markets and promotes awareness of the NSS;
  • leads cross-cutting NSS projects (including pilot projects for the National Data Network);
  • promotes the development of tools and skills both within the ABS and across the NSS; and
  • supports associated initiatives and forums (such as the Community of Users and Producers of Statistics (CUPS) and the Australian Government Statistical Forum).

The NDN Business Office provides secretariat support for the NDN Interim Governing Board and develops policy proposals for Board approval. In addition to their secretariat role, the Business office also undertakes:
  • provision of business analysis for potential NDN clients;
  • managing the NDN website, which is the main communication channel to users, custodians and interested organisations;
  • production of the monthly NDN newsletter;
  • managing the ABS Node including all registrations for the NDN;
  • provision of specifications to the development team for NDN technical development; and
  • production of documentation including business rules, participation agreements, metadata requirements, manuals and help support.
